Output 8e92431304cf9f4750075c24c901b19605af1ec44f8f0e2a4a310b113aab0059:1

value
12272736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b62889311b1d865fb80191a91c5127f3fb7aedfd OP_EQUAL
address
3JJBTwXiuCtsZHZoquLbCEVK5HBbWAebZ7
transaction
8e92431304cf9f4750075c24c901b19605af1ec44f8f0e2a4a310b113aab0059
spent
true